Bryan Hovey

Job Titles:
  • Web Developer
Bryan joined Key Media and Research in October 2002 after earning a Web Development diploma from Strayer University. His biggest strengths are programming applications and troubleshooting/problem solving. With an intuitive knack for IT he is also called upon to assist with many computer related items throughout the company. Prior to becoming part of the KMR team, Bryan served as an Avionics Communications Specialist (aircraft radio technician) in the United States Air Force and received an Outstanding Unit Award for his participation in Operation Urgent Fury (Grenada 1983) and an Outstanding Service Commendation for his timely troubleshooting and repair of a radio system problem on a C-130 Hercules aircraft that was preparing to fly a training mission. Because of his efforts, the aircrew and Fort Bragg service members on board were able to complete their training for the day. Upon his discharge from the USAF, he primarily worked in the food and beverage industry for the next 19 years, having held every position from dishwasher to General Manager. Bryan received the 2020 Award for Extraordinary Service (Holly X. Carter Biller Award) which is presented annually by KMR.

Daniel Snow had been part of the team at Key Media and research since 2014 and was tapped to manage its sister company, Glass.com®, in 2016. While under his management, Glass.com earned first place awards from the Software & Information Industry Association (SIIA) for Best New or Relaunched Website and Graphic Design (GD) USA for website design, while continuing to grow steadily year-over-year. He holds a Bachelor's Degree in Business Management from George Mason University, and has been able to put his numerous skills and attributes to use at glass-related events. Daniel has helped educate consumers about glass by working alongside TV personalities such as Richard Rawlings from Discovery Channel's Fast and Loud, Dustin Anderson from HGTV's Fixer Upper, and Susan Hogan from News4 Washington. Daniel's drive and leadership abilities are evident in all aspects of his life. In 2022 Daniel acted as a crew chief in Race Across America, "the world's toughest bike race", leading 4 racers and 10 crew to a first place victory and new world record. His passion for precision, and ability to collaborate with and manage a team, only aids in his ability to produce high quality results.

Ellen Rogers

Job Titles:
  • Director
  • Vice President of Editorial Content
Ellen Rogers is the editorial/content director for Key Media & Research (KMR), as well as the editor of the company's flagship publication, USG lass magazine. With over two decades of experience in the field, she is well-known as a leading voice in the glass industry, covering a wide range of topics, including industry news, product information, design trends and installation techniques. Ellen began her career at USG lass magazine as an assistant editor in 2000, and later served as managing editor before being promoted to editor. Under Ellen's leadership, USG lass has grown to become the premier source of information for the glass industry in North America. Ellen is a five-time Jesse H. Neal Award finalist-considered the "Pulitzer of B2B journalism," and was the Neal winner in 2022 in the Best Technical/Scientific Content category. She has also won multiple regional and national Azbees from the American Society of Business Publication Editors. She was also received KMR's Holly X. Biller Award for Extraordinary Service, the company's highest honor, in 2014. Ellen has a bachelor's degree in communication from Peace College in Raleigh, N.C., and is currently pursuing a master's degree in digital communication from the University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ill. She also completed the Yale Publishing Course at the Yale School of Management in 2015.

Holly Biller - President

Job Titles:
  • President
Holly Biller is president of Key Media & Research (KMR), publisher of USG lass, DWM, AGRR, Window Film and Paint Protection Film (PPF) magazines, and has been with the company for more than 25 years. Holly also has served as Auto Glass Week™ and the International Window Film Conference and Tint-Off™ master of ceremonies since they commenced. She joined what was then Key Communications Inc. (now KMR) in high school, and worked in various sales and marketing roles before being promoted to vice president of media services in 2006. During this time, she was instrumental in the development of digital services. In addition, Holly has been involved with planning of the International Window Film Conference and Tint-Off™ and Auto Glass Week as well as many Glass Expo regional events since their inception. She also has lead the creation of digital editions, online products, video news reports, special events and services spanning the automotive, architectural and markets aligned or allied to the glass industries. During the pandemic, she crafted a fully interactive digital event to support USG lass and GlassCon Global in September 2020. This was one of the most extensive platforms for sessions, digital trade exhibits and networking. She now heads up efforts with online product offerings, highly engaging digital issues and other avenues to connect readers with the latest news and information. Holly graduated Magna Cum Laude from James Madison University and holds a bachelor's of science in speech communication with a concentration in public relations and a double minor in business and advertising. She is a proud baseball mother of two sons and wife of Captain Thomas Biller for Fairfax County Fire & Rescue. The KMR Holly X. Biller Award for Extraordinary Service, the company's highest achievement, was named in her honor.

Saundra Hutchison

Job Titles:
  • Art Director
  • Graphic Designer
Saundra Hutchison is a seasoned art director and graphic designer with over 35 years of experience in the graphic design field. She earned her BFA degree in graphic design from the Corcoran School of Art + Design in Washington, D.C. She started her design career in the newspaper field, but went on to work as an art director and graphic designer for associations, magazines, start-up companies, non-profits and graphic design firms. Her creative abilities range from commercial and industrial graphics to all forms of print collateral, advertising, publication design and corporate branding. At Key Media & Research (KMR), Saundra's design responsibilities include eight magazines, corporate print materials for KMR and Glass.com, and all forms of creative design work for KMR's nine industry trade shows and two associations. Saundra has received numerous accolades for her advertisements, and awards for newspaper tabloid and campaign design work from the MDDC and VA press associations. She was also featured in David E. Carter's Big Book of New Design Ideas. Since she has been with KMR, Saundra has won over fifteen ASBPE National and/or Regional Gold, Silver and Bronze design awards for her work on Architects' Guide to Glass & Metal (AGG), Auto Glass Repair and Replacement (AGRR), Door and Window Market [DWM], Window Film and USG lass magazines.

Tricia Lopez

Job Titles:
  • Senior Events Director
Tricia Lopez is the senior events director for Key Media & Research (KMR), publisher of USG lass, DWM, AGRR™, Window Film and Paint Protection Film (PPF) magazines. She has held the role since 2020. Tricia oversees the planning and execution of KMR trade shows, including Auto Glass Week™, International Window Film Conference and Tint-Off™ (WFCT), and many regional Glass Expos. She joined the company's meetings and conferences department in 2013 as the competition coordinator for Auto Glass Week™ and WFCT, as well as the educational program coordinator for the regional Glass Expos. Over the years, Tricia has been involved with planning various events including association meetings and staff outings, and supporting other allied industry events, such as GlassCon Global (2016 and 2020.) Tricia holds a bachelor of arts in marketing from the University of North Texas and a graduate certificate in online communications and web design from the University of Florida. In 2015, she was the recipient of KMR's Holly X. Biller Award for Extraordinary Service, the company's highest achievement, in recognition of propelling Auto Glass Week™ and WFCT forward and giving all competitors and supporters a high caliber event they deserve.
